Sacred Grief- A timely new book shows you what to do in the face of suffering

You will really enjoy this conversation with Leslee Tessmann, the author of the new book, Sacred Grief.

We all experience grief- loss of a loved one, a cross-country move, death of a dream, or any of the small losses that we encounter daily.

We also wonder what to do to support our friends who are in the midst of grief. Words can seem so inadequate.

Leslee Tessmann experienced many losses in her life. Through devastating grief, she learned not only to cope with her losses, but to make friends with her grief so that she could learn from it.

In this interview, we talk about how to know if you are supressing your grief or wallowing in it. Leslee shares practical tips that you can use to make any experience of grief sacred and part of your soul's evolution.
